German aid for AP power sector

AP got a major boost in the power sector, Germany has agreed to extend Rs 476 crore interest-free loan for development of a green energy corridor in the state. The AP Transco has been identified as the developer for the first of its kind project in the country. The green corridor will evacuate power generated by solar and wind power projects which are under construction in Rayalaseema districts.

appowerThe funds will be utilized for the green power corridor in Anantapur, Kurnool, Kadapa and Chittoor districts, where many solar and wind power projects are coming up. This will be the first green corridor in the country with dedicated transmission and distribution network.

The German government has already participated in the funding of Krishnapatnam thermal power project and the green corridor will be the second big investment by Germany in Andhra Pradesh. The financial assistance comes without any interest except covering the foreign exchange fluctuations.

“This will work out at about one per cent and the state was given three years to complete the project,” P Satyamurthy, director finance of AP Transco, told TOI after signing the agreement with the German government in the presence of Prime Minister Narendra Modi and German Chancellor Angela Merkel in New Delhi .

The green energy corridor will also serve as a major transmission line to evacuate power generated in wind power projects in Anantapur in AP, Tamil Nadu and Karnataka.
